Description & Requirements

About the role:

We have a fantastic opportunity for a Talent Acquisition Advisor to join our International Headquarters People & Performance team as a Talent Acquisition Specialist! This role will be based out of our London office and will play a key role in supporting recruitment across R&D- Operations and Commercials BU's in our international zone.

You will play a key role in driving the business towards strategic hiring decisions through an efficient and effective recruitment process aligned to the global hiring policy. Proactively network and build a strong talent pools for key functions within the business.

Responsibilities:

  • Manage the Talent Acquisition process maintaining compliance with company policies and legislative requirements
  • Ensure the end-to-end process is being led through our Workday system.
  • Champion best-practice recruitment hiring- promoting a long -term strategic business talent solutions.
  • Ensure the recruitment process is run efficiently focusing on providing a professional and positive candidate experience.
  • Provide creative solutions to source top talent in the market.
  • Utilise data and analytics to make decisions and recommendations on recruitment strategies- sharing and consulting with hiring managers as appropriate
  • Continually network and proactively source top talent to build a talent pipeline for future opportunities
  • Remain abreast with industry trends- insights and events to ensure KraftHeinz remains relevant and attractive.

About you:

  • Work as part of a team but also demonstrate ability to confidently operate with autonomy
  • Strong attention to detail
  • Ability to multitask and manage stakeholder expectations to ensure key deliverables are met
  • Think outside the box and solution driven approach to work.
  • Undergraduate qualification in Commerce/Human Resources or related discipline is desirable

About Us

The Kraft Heinz Company is one of the largest food and beverage companies in the world, with eight $1 billion+ brands and global sales of approximately $25 billion. We’re a globally trusted producer of high-quality, great-tasting, and nutritious foods for over 150 years. Our brands are truly global, with products produced and marketed in over 40 countries. These beloved products include condiments and sauces, cheese and dairy, meals, meats, refreshment beverages, coffee, infant and nutrition products, and numerous other grocery products in a portfolio of more than 200 legacy and emerging brands.

No matter the brand, we’re united under one vision: To sustainably grow by delighting more consumers globally. Bringing this vision to life is our team of 39,000+ food lovers, creative thinkers, and high performers worldwide. Together, we help provide meals to those in need through our global partnership with Rise Against Hunger. We also stand committed to responsible, sustainable practices that extend to every facet of our business, our consumers, and our communities. Every day, we’re transforming the food industry with bold thinking and unprecedented results.
